In 1860, the Philadelphia Mint produced a run of 36,514 gold dollars. These small, delicate coins represent a fascinating chapter in United States coinage, minted in 90 percent pure gold with a total gold content of 0.0484 troy ounces. Today, surviving examples from this era are highly prized, especially those that have escaped the wear and tear of circulation. This specific coin is an exceptional survivor, certified in an elite MS-67+ condition. At this grade level, the coin retains its original luster and sharp details just as it looked when it left the coining press over a century and a half ago. The obverse features the classic Indian Head portrait, while the reverse clearly displays the denomination of 1 DOLLAR alongside the 1860 date, serving as a stunning testament to the artistry of mid-nineteenth-century American minting.
